Can UK Meet Its 2030 5G and Broadband Targets?

The United Kingdom has set ambitious targets for the rollout of 5G and gigabit-capable broadband by the end of the decade. As the year 2030 approaches, doubts are emerging among policymakers and industry leaders alike regarding the feasibility of these goals. While there is widespread acknowledgment of the importance of enhanced digital infrastructure for the country’s competitiveness and quality of life, numerous obstacles loom on the horizon.

Examining the Confidence Levels

A recent survey by Cluttons and YouGov has shone a light on the skepticism that prevails within the ranks of UK Members of Parliament, particularly among Conservatives. Only a third of Conservative MPs have expressed confidence in meeting the targets for 5G, while confidence in gigabit broadband is marginally higher. The outlook among Labour MPs is even bleaker, with virtually no confidence in the broadband objective and only a fraction showing optimism for 5G. Despite the palpable demand from their constituencies for improved connectivity, MPs seem unsure. They cite the populace’s limited grasp of the benefits that advanced digital infrastructure would bring, raising the issue of public awareness as a hurdle that needs addressing.

The consensus among MPs is clear: there is a distinct discrepancy between the constituents’ demands for better connectivity and the actual progress toward the targets. An overwhelming majority acknowledge the necessity for stronger services in their areas, yet they sense a gap in the public’s understanding of why such advancements are crucial. This gap extends beyond mere statistics or technological complexities—it touches on the very fabric of the UK’s potential for innovation, economic growth, and social inclusion in an increasingly digitized global landscape.
